DaVita re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$2.87, surpassing the consensus estimate of $2.34 by 22.59%. Revenue details were not disclosed in the earnings release. The stock closed down 0.07% in the trading session following the announcement, possibly reflecting a tempered market reaction despite the significant earnings surprise.

DaVita’s first-quarter results were driven by robust operational execution across its core U.S. dialysis business. The company reported a 22.6% EPS beat, which management attributed to continued efficiency improvements, favorable patient census trends, and disciplined cost management. While revenue figures were not provided, the earnings strength suggests that DaVita successfully navigated reimbursement headwinds and maintained patient volumes. Operating margins may have benefited from lower supply costs and higher treatment throughput. The company’s integrated kidney care strategy, including value-based arrangements and home dialysis programs, likely supported margin stability. DaVita also continued to leverage its scale to optimize labor scheduling and reduce overtime expenses. The quarter reflects the resilience of DaVita’s business model, even as the broader healthcare sector faces inflationary pressures. No specific segment breakdown was disclosed, but the core dialysis operations remain the primary contributor to profitability.

DaVita’s strategic focus continues to center on expanding integrated care models and driving patient outcomes through home dialysis. The company has invested in telehealth infrastructure and care coordination platforms, which may yield additional cost savings over time. While formal guidance was not updated in the release, DaVita anticipates that ongoing efficiency initiatives and a stable patient base will support earnings momentum. However, risk factors persist. Labor market tightness and wage inflation could pressure margins in future periods, and any adverse changes to Medicare reimbursement policies may affect revenue growth. DaVita also faces regulatory scrutiny around its clinical practices and billing procedures. The company expects to maintain a disciplined capital allocation approach, prioritizing reinvestment in high-return growth initiatives and share repurchases when appropriate.

The stock’s modest decline of 0.07% after a substantial EPS beat suggests that the market may have already priced in strong performance, or that investors are awaiting more clarity on revenue and patient volume trends. Analysts noted the positive surprise but expressed caution regarding the lack of revenue disclosure, which limits full assessment of top-line health. Some analysts maintained a neutral stance, highlighting that DaVita’s valuation already reflects its operational improvements. Investment implications center on the company’s ability to sustain margin expansion amid cost pressures. Key metrics to watch include treatment volume growth and any updates on contract negotiations with commercial payers. Regulatory developments, particularly in Medicare payment rates, could significantly influence future earnings. DaVita’s consistent execution may provide a buffer, but near-term catalysts remain tied to industry-wide shifts in kidney care delivery.
